Wickes sell a range of exterior screws / bolts etc that have a green
coating described as "organic". Anyone know what this coating is, and
how resistant it may be ?
Probably a fluoropolymer.
They usually offer much better protection than any basic plating
process. Lots of vehicle manufacturers at the "high end" are now
routinely using them in exposed locations.
